Type 1 Diabetes Causes, Diagnosis, And Treatment Explained

Type 1 diabetes, an auto-immune disorder, is one of the most widespread chronic diseases that usually affects children or young adults. Hence, type 1 diabetes is also known as juvenile diabetes. Let us discover more about type 1 diabetes.

How does type 1 diabetes occur?

Type 1 diabetes causes the body’s immune system to mistakenly attack and destroy insulin-producing beta cells present in the pancreas. Insulin is nothing but a certain hormone that is responsible for transporting glucose through blood (derived from the food we eat) to various parts of the body.

As the pancreas is not able to produce enough insulin, it limits the glucose to move throughout the body. As a result, glucose stays and gets accumulated in the blood, thereby increasing blood glucose levels. This condition is referred to as type 1 diabetes. A person having type 1 diabetes can fall sick gradually and may even get dehydrated if not diagnosed on-time.

Are there any early warning signs?

... of type 1 diabetes is gradual and not sudden. An individual affected by the disorder usually experiences classic warning signs such as:

● An urge to eat and drink more
● Lack of energy, tiredness
● Unintended weight loss
● Increased urination

Without a timely diagnosis, type 1 diabetes symptoms can worsen and take a toll on the patient’s health. A type 1 diabetic may also experience vomiting, abdominal pain, and breathing-related problems along with dehydration.

Is there any diagnostic test for type 1 diabetes?

Yes, absolutely. In fact, nowadays, diagnostic tests for type 1 diabetes are easily available at all leading doctors, diabetes caregivers, and other medical professionals. Once you notice any of the above type 1 diabetes signs, make sure you check and consult with your doctor at the earliest.

Some of the most common diagnostic test for type 1 diabetes includes Glycated Hemoglobin (A1C Test), random blood sugar test, and fasting blood sugar test.

Once diagnosed with type 1 diabetes your doctor may also conduct a couple of blood tests to check for the prevalence of any auto-antibodies, which are very common in type 1 diabetes.

Additionally, diagnostic tests for type 1 diabetes may also help your doctor or caregiver to bifurcate between type 1 and type 2 diabetes. That’s because signs and symptoms of diabetes -- whether type 1 or type 2, is much similar to each other.

What are the treatment options?

Unfortunately, there is no proper cure available for type 1 diabetes, as it is a lifelong disease. Type 1 diabetes treatment and prevention methods including:

● Insulin therapy
● Keeping a check on carbs, fats, and proteins intake
● Monitoring blood sugar frequently
● Eating healthy foods in moderation
● Exercising regularly

Type 1 diabetics who maintain a healthy weight by following a nutrition-rich diet and regular physical exercise, have lesser chances of developing further complications. The only key to lead a contented life with diabetes is to keep blood sugar levels at bay, for which healthy eating habits and an active lifestyle play a very crucial role.
